Abstract
An innovative solution to slip rings and plug connectors is the contactless energy transmission system which is aligned to resonance. For an efficient energy transmission high frequencies (around 100 kHz) as well as an operation in resonance is useful. Some applications need a single-phase (50 Hz) supply a new energy conversion principle can be used to solve the problem. This paper describes a new converter topology and the development of the necessary control signals for the secondary and the primary circuit which provides a single-phase 50 Hz voltage on the secondary side without a need for a DC link. Moreover, practical tests and measurements are presented.
